15 films to keep on your radar for SXSW 2024.

For the fourth year in a row, Elements of Madness will officially be covering SXSW and we thought we’d offer up our recommendations of what to check out during the fest or what to keep an eye out for in wider distribution.

**These recommendations are solely based on reading the summaries and finding them intriguing.**

SXSW 2024 banner

SXSW 2024 takes place in Austin, Texas from March 8th – March 16th, 2024.

Freaknik: The Wildest Party Never Told

Official Synopsis:

Freaknik: The Wildest Party Never Told is a celebratory exploration of the boisterous times of Freaknik, the iconic Atlanta street party that drew hundreds of thousands of people in the 80s and 90s, helping put Atlanta on the map culturally.


Grand Theft Hamlet

Official Synopsis:

Shot entirely inside the video game Grand Theft Auto, this documentary charts the hilarious and profoundly moving story of two out of work actors as they try to stage a full production of Hamlet within this notoriously violent digital world.

The Hobby

Official Synopsis:

Are games the meaning of life? The Hobby is a funny, affectionate, character-driven portrait of the massive subculture of modern board games, featuring a fascinating and diverse group of subjects who find deep meaning in “meaningless” pursuits.
